Australian missionary Martin Chan hopes Cambodian Prime Minister Hun Sen will intervene to resolve charges of “criminal fraud” that have led to a three-month stint behind bars.
Access to Hun Sen was offered after Chan won the support of Sok Sovann Vathana Sabung, a key member of the Supreme Consultation Forum (SCF) and president of the Khmer Rise Party (KRP).
“I hope that Hun Sen or his cabinet will take a look at this case and see if there’s anything unusual,” 49-year-old Chan said.
